The contract involves the supply and delivery of ten precision-machined Sprayer Plates, Oil BU, designated as Item No. 2 of Drawing D-42042, specifically engineered to meet the technical requirements for defense oil burner systems. These components are critical to the operational integrity of naval oil burner equipment and must be manufactured to exacting standards to ensure compatibility, durability, and performance under demanding conditions. The work is classified under NAICS code 332721, indicating it pertains to machine shops and related manufacturing services. This is a Small Business Set Aside contract, meaning only eligible small businesses may compete for award, and it is issued as a subcontract under the Department of Defense through Navsup Fleet Logistics Center Puget Sound. The solicitation was posted on July 31, 2026, with a firm response deadline of August 10, 2026, at 9:00 PM Eastern Time. The place of performance and specific delivery location are not detailed, but the requirement is tied to defense systems, implying fulfillment will support military readiness. Access to the full solicitation details is available through the SAM.gov portal.
